Pagina 1 din 1

Extragere litere din cuvinte si inca ceva

Scris: Vin Dec 05, 2008 7:45 pm
de Gospodar

Scris: Vin Dec 05, 2008 8:24 pm
de Gospodar

Scris: Vin Dec 05, 2008 8:44 pm
de Amenthes
Uite o metoda mai obfuscata, dar draguta dupa parerea mea :)

[php]
<?php

$string = 'fOruZ';

$from = array_map('chr', array_merge(range(65, 89), range(97, 121)));
$to = array_map('chr', array_merge(range(66, 90), range(98, 122)));
$trans = array_combine($from, $to);

echo strtr($string, $trans);

?>
[/php]

Scris: Vin Dec 05, 2008 9:14 pm
de Gospodar

Scris: Sâm Dec 06, 2008 3:18 am
de lorand1

Scris: Sâm Dec 06, 2008 12:20 pm
de Gospodar

Scris: Sâm Dec 06, 2008 4:40 pm
de dechim
@Gospodar
Pune dupa fiecare rand print_r($var), unde $var este variabila din randul anterior si vezi ce fac fiecare, ca sa nu mai vb de manual.
Si eu am zis fara rautate

Scris: Sâm Dec 06, 2008 6:25 pm
de lorand1
array_map() , range() , array_slice() , array_push() , current() , aray_merge() , array_combine() sunt functii de tratare a tablourilor si le gasesti in manual

chr() , strtr() sunt functii de tratare string-uri si le gasesti in maual

ti-as sugera sa ai o lectura placuta sa ti le insusesti ca le vei folosi mai incolo, si iti vor prinde bine

daca nu intelegi comportamentul la careva dintre ele poti intreba ca ti se va raspunde

spor

Scris: Sâm Dec 06, 2008 7:07 pm
de Amenthes